Legal & Tax Perspectives on Business Cards

Tax Deductibility of Business Cards

Business cards are considered deductible as advertising or marketing expenses. According to the IRS, most marketing and advertising costs—like business cards—can be included on your tax return. This deduction helps reduce your overall tax liability while boosting your marketing efforts. Learn how to turn your business cards into promotional material that serves dual purposes of branding and advertising.

Expense Categorization

From a tax perspective, business cards fall under "advertising and marketing expenses." Since their primary purpose is promotional, they align with activities aimed at generating leads and increasing business visibility. By categorizing them correctly, businesses ensure compliance while optimizing expenses.

Broader Marketing Expense Connections

The IRS recognizes business cards as a component of marketing. Other examples in this category include domain names, print ads, promotional materials, website hosting, and video production. Design Elements That Make Cards More Promotional

Designing business cards with a promotional edge transforms them into impactful advertising tools for networking and branding. Effective design elements drive engagement and leave lasting impressions, aligning with strategic marketing goals. Here's how to make business cards more promotional:

1. Incorporate Branding Elements

Highlight logos, corporate colors, and taglines on the card. Strong graphics, consistent with your overall branding, reinforce identity. For example, a modern color palette with bold typography showcases professionalism. Incorporating corporate branding builds recognition and ensures recipients recall your business.

2. Add Interactive Features

Use QR codes or personalized URLs to connect potential clients to online content. Examples include links to websites, promotional deals, or portfolio showcases. QR codes boost interactivity, creating a seamless connection between the physical card and digital platforms.

3. Leverage Premium Printing Options

Customized finishes amplify the card's visual appeal and perceived value. Options like spot UV, embossed textures, and die-cut shapes engage recipients. With unique textures and finishes, cards stand out in competitive networking settings. 4OVER4.COM elevates these designs through custom printing solutionslink icon, enhancing professional impressions.

4. Use Limited-Time Promotions

Incorporate offers or discounts directly on the card design. For instance, adding "10% off with this card" motivates clients to keep and use it, driving engagement. Highlighting exclusivity ensures the card serves dual purposes: contact sharing and promotional material.

5. Include Easy-To-Understand Layouts

A well-organized design ensures recipients process critical details quickly. Clear hierarchy, clean fonts, and strategic spacing communicate professionalism. Every design decision should prioritize readability and promotional value.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. Are business cards considered advertising or office expenses?

Business cards are generally classified as advertising expenses. They serve as marketing tools that promote brand awareness and facilitate connections. According to the IRS, business cards fall under "advertising and marketing expenses," making them deductible while contributing to your overall marketing strategy.
